I don't think I've ever seen someone talk so passionately about their business as much as the style-savvy Kuwaiti entrepreneur Sarah Al Wazzan did. Sarah invited me to her boutique Kico Kids @Panacheous , which had its grand opening a couple of weeks ago at Discovery Mall in Kuwait City. The boutique's shabby chic décor, with its hanging monkeys/mini mannequins and floral wallpaper on the main entrance, matched perfectly with the modern style clothing and accessories. The boutique is segmented into two sections, the first section offers a well-selected assortment of women's clothes and accessories, which I will be posting about tomorrow as I don't want to bombard you with photos. It also included some kids related trinkets and nick-nacks here and there, and then there is the bigger section which is catered to kids-only brand Kico Kids .  If you're looking for plain boring shorts or polo shirts, then look somewhere else. Louboutin For Him and Her

I said it before, and I'll say it again, I'm not a huge Christian Louboutin fan, but every now and then I do pop inside the boutique to check out his latest designs, after all he does design a pair or two that I get attracted to every season. But generally speaking, I know that I won't be forking over my savings just for the luxury of wearing red-soled heels. That doesn't mean I never bought from Louboutin , but the heels that I get attracted to and buy have to look unique, wearable (not necessarily comfortable unfortunately), and basically make a statement. Plus the fact that there are more power players in the shoes arena, makes me more inclined to pop in, admire, and then leave. So today I'm sharing with you two pairs that I admired at the brand's boutique in Salhiya Complex, one for the ladies and one for the gents, to admire at the.
